What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Boston to Providenciales?

The average price of all flights from Boston to Providenciales cl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
For Boston to Providenciales, Tuesday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Saturday is the most expensive. Flying from Providenciales back to Boston, the best deals are generally found on Monday, with Sunday being the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Boston to Providenciales?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Boston to Providenciales,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Boston to Providenciales is May, where tickets cost $463 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are October and April, where the average cost of tickets is $671 and $649 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Boston to Providenciales?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Boston to Providenciales,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Boston to Providenciales,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 76 days before departure.

How many flights are there between Boston and Providenciales per day?

There is a maximum of 1 nonstop flight a day that takes off from Boston and lands in Providenciales, with an average flight time of 3h 45m. The most common departure time is 12:00 pm and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 3 flights.

How long does a flight from Boston to Providenciales take?

Direct flights cover the 1,424 miles separating Boston to Providenciales in about 3h 45m.
